Meet Lameck.
Lameck joined his Kinship Project in Kenya in 2010 after enduring a traumatic life on the streets. Over the years, Lameck blossomed into a leader among his peers. He studied hard in school, did well on his final exams, and even taught classes at his local primary school! And through it all, he held tight to his dream of becoming a medical professional one day.
Thanks to his determination—and your generous support—Lameck’s dream is now close to becoming a reality.
We’re thrilled to share that in December, Lameck completed his diploma as a clinical medicine student! That is a long-term impact that doesn't just benefit Lameck, but also those he will care for.
